| Abstract: | Expert Systems are systems built to imitate human experts in problem solving and decision making. Medical Expert Systems are breakthrough in medicine and proved beneficial in multiple critical areas such as Intensive Care Units(ICUs). Diabetes Mellitus is a chronic disease that affects a large population in the world. With this in mind, we aim to improve the diagnosis and evaluation process for diabetes by utilizing artificial intelligence technology to build and validate a prototype expert system . This expert system will be able to: - Perform correct screening, - Deduct if the patient is diabetic or not, if so, determines the type of diabetes, and its severity, or its complications and risks if not diabetic. - Suggest appropriate treatment. Thus, the system serve as a health education and awareness system. We are aiming to implementation of a prototype medical expert system to aid nurses . nurses may use the software (diabetes tracer ) as a diagnostic and reference tool . the software can facilitate early detection and diagnosis of diabetes . the prototype uses a knowledge-based system with a front-end text-based interface that enables nurses to answer diagnostic questions and enter laboratory results . the system output is the diagnosis and treatment plan to be followed . |
